First off, from the problem, we see that this polygon has six sides. Any type of polygon with 6 sides, regardless its classification, is called a "hexagon" of some form. So, eliminate all the answer choices that do not include the word "hexagon".
We're now left with "convex hexagon" and "concave hexagon". We need to define these terms. "Convex" polygons have all their vertices pointing away from the interior, while "concave" polygons have at least one vertex pointing inwards toward the center of the shape.
If concave polygons have some vertices inside the polygon, then when connecting vertices to each other (these segments are called "diagonals"), the diagonals will not necessarily be contained within the polygon. Looking back at the problem, we see that this describes what we want.
Thus, the answer is "concave hexagon".
